OKUN BUSINESS LEADER,  CHIEF OLU OWA, THROWS WEIGHT BEHIND TINUBU, ODODO

A prominent Okun son and Lagos-based international businessman, Chief Olu Owa, has pledged his support for President Bola Tinubu’s re-election bid and Governor Usman Ododo’s second term in Kogi State.

Owa made the declaration in Lagos, expressing confidence in Tinubu’s “renewed agenda” and Ododo’s achievements in Kogi State.

“I believe in the renewed agenda of President Tinubu and the reported achievements of Governor Usman Ododo,” Owa said.

He commended the Olope group for countering negative narratives about the government, saying it’s crucial to set the record straight.

Hon Alfred Bello, Director-General of Olope, praised Owa as a “worthy son of Okun” and lauded Governor Ododo’s performance, saying he’s made significant strides in a short time.

“Governor Usman Ododo is a good product that needs no stress to market because of his remarkable performance,” Bello said.

This endorsement adds to the growing list of supporters backing Tinubu’s re-election bid.
